    Cannabis Business Entity Formation: Building a Strong Legal Foundation for Your Cannabis Company

    Starting a cannabis business requires more than choosing a name and filing paperwork. Because the cannabis industry operates under complex state regulations, strict licensing requirements, and evolving legal challenges, selecting the right business structure is one of the most important steps for long-term success.

    Proper Cannabis Business Entity Formation helps entrepreneurs create a strong foundation for their operations, protect personal assets, establish clear ownership rights, and prepare their companies for future growth. Whether you are launching a cannabis cultivation business, dispensary, manufacturing company, distribution operation, or ancillary cannabis service, the right legal structure can make a significant difference.

    Why Cannabis Business Entity Formation Matters

    Unlike traditional businesses, cannabis companies must navigate additional regulatory requirements at the state and local levels. The entity structure you choose can impact ownership disclosures, licensing approvals, taxes, liability protection, investment opportunities, and daily operations.

    A properly structured cannabis company can help:

    • Separate personal and business liabilities
    • Create clear ownership and management responsibilities
    • Support investor relationships
    • Improve operational organization
    • Prepare the business for expansion or acquisition opportunities

    Working with an experienced cannabis business attorney during formation can help avoid costly mistakes that may create compliance problems later.

    Choosing the Right Business Structure for a Cannabis Company

    The first step in forming a cannabis business is selecting the appropriate entity type. Different structures offer different benefits depending on the company’s goals, ownership arrangement, and operational needs.

    Limited Liability Company (LLC)

    Many cannabis entrepreneurs choose an LLC because it can provide liability protection while allowing flexibility in management and ownership.

    An LLC may help business owners:

    • Define ownership percentages
    • Create customized management structures
    • Establish operating agreements
    • Provide protections between personal and business assets

    However, cannabis LLCs must still comply with industry-specific regulations and ownership disclosure requirements.

    Corporation

    Corporations may be suitable for cannabis businesses seeking outside investment or planning significant growth. A corporate structure can provide a formal framework for shareholders, directors, and management responsibilities.

    Cannabis corporations often require careful planning regarding:

    • Share ownership
    • Investor agreements
    • Regulatory disclosures
    • Corporate governance documents

    Partnerships and Other Structures

    Some cannabis businesses may consider partnerships or other arrangements depending on their goals. However, these structures require careful legal planning because ownership rights, financial responsibilities, and regulatory obligations must be clearly defined.

    Cannabis Ownership and Regulatory Compliance Considerations

    Cannabis companies face unique compliance requirements that traditional businesses do not. State cannabis regulators often require detailed information about owners, investors, managers, and financial interests connected to the company.

    During entity formation, cannabis businesses may need to address:

    • Ownership disclosure requirements
    • License-holder responsibilities
    • Background check considerations
    • Social equity requirements
    • Investment and financing structures
    • Local and state licensing rules

    Building compliance into the company structure from the beginning can help prevent delays during the licensing process.

    Creating Strong Corporate Governance Documents

    A successful cannabis business needs more than a registered entity. Strong internal documents help establish how the company operates and how decisions are made.

    Important documents may include:

    • Operating agreements
    • Shareholder agreements
    • Investment agreements
    • Management agreements
    • Buy-sell provisions
    • Ownership transfer restrictions

    These documents can help prevent disputes between business partners and provide guidance when ownership changes occur.

    Protecting Cannabis Business Owners From Legal Risks

    Cannabis businesses face unique risks related to regulations, contracts, investments, and partnerships. Without proper planning, owners may face unnecessary financial exposure or operational challenges.

    A carefully designed business structure can help address:

    • Partner disagreements
    • Investor expectations
    • Contractual obligations
    • Ownership disputes
    • Future business transactions

    Early legal planning allows entrepreneurs to create systems that support compliance and business growth.

    Preparing Your Cannabis Business for Investment and Expansion

    Many cannabis companies eventually seek outside funding, partnerships, or acquisition opportunities. A properly formed entity can make the business more attractive to investors and strategic partners.

    Investors typically want to understand:

    • Who owns the company
    • How profits are distributed
    • How decisions are made
    • Whether the company follows regulatory requirements
    • Whether the business has proper documentation

    A strong corporate foundation can help position a cannabis company for future opportunities.

    Suggested FAQs

    1. What is cannabis business entity formation?
    Cannabis business entity formation is the process of legally creating a company structure for operating a cannabis-related business while addressing ownership, liability, and regulatory requirements.

    2. Do I need a lawyer to form a cannabis business?
    While not always legally required, working with a cannabis business attorney can help ensure your company structure aligns with industry regulations and licensing requirements.

    3. What type of entity is best for a cannabis business?
    The best structure depends on your business goals, ownership plans, investment needs, and regulatory considerations. Common options include LLCs and corporations.

    4. Can cannabis businesses receive investors?
    Yes, but cannabis investments require careful planning because ownership interests and financial arrangements may need to comply with applicable regulations.
